问题标签 [kill]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
427 浏览

unix - 一些迭代后删除:是 | rm -r .git

经过一些迭代后,我需要杀死“yes”命令,有两种方法:

a) 杀死它

b)一段时间后将“n”作为输入

您将如何自动删除 .git 目录?

0 投票
2 回答
409 浏览

sockets - 通过级别和 kill-9 的套接字故障来查看内核

Kill-9-signalling 所有 postgres 进程在命令后立即引发错误:

长期计算机科学问题

测试的目的是模拟一个严重的致命错误,由于套接字故障而窥视内核。在崩溃恢复等情况下,这是一种很好的做法。

  1. 它与x86的0和3级别有关吗?
  2. 9-killing对kernel和fs等东西做了什么?
  3. 插座有什么问题?
  4. 在信号发送期间文件发生了什么与副作用有关的情况?
0 投票
3 回答
1737 浏览

objective-c - 使用 AuthorizationExecuteWithPrivileges 启动后终止进程

如果我使用 AuthorizationExecuteWithPrivileges 启动一个 shell 脚本,那么杀死脚本和它产生的任何其他进程的最简单方法是什么。

谢谢

0 投票
1 回答
10930 浏览

iphone - 如何用Objective C杀死一个线程?

我调用了一个第三方 C++ 库,该库已放入它自己的线程(当前使用 NSThread)。我想让用户能够停止执行该线程。(我很清楚这可能导致的所有问题,但我仍然希望这样做。)

根据Apple 的 Thread Programming Guide,Cocoa 有可能这样做。iPhone 也是如此,还是我必须依靠 Posix 线程来实现我的目标?

干杯

法师先生

0 投票
5 回答
34861 浏览

python - 运行一个进程,如果它在一小时内没有结束,则终止它

我需要在 Python 中执行以下操作。我想生成一个进程(子进程模块?),并且:

  • 如果进程正常结束,则从它终止的那一刻开始继续;
  • 如果,否则,进程“卡住”并且没有在(比如说)一小时内终止,则杀死它并继续(可能再试一次,在一个循环中)。

完成此任务的最优雅方法是什么?

0 投票
2 回答
12083 浏览

c# - 如何检测终止进程事​​件

在 C# 中我使用 process.Kill() 杀死一个进程,同时在被杀死的应用程序中如何检测此事件?

顺便说一句:Application.ApplicationExit 事件尚未被触发!

0 投票
3 回答
3276 浏览

process - 当进程在 Windows 和 Linux 中终止时如何获得通知?

我想编写一个程序,只要该操作系统上的任何正在运行的进程死亡,操作系统就应该通知该程序。

如果先前存在的进程已经死亡,我不想每次都进行轮询和比较。我希望我的程序在进程终止时收到操作系统的警报。

我该怎么做?一些示例代码会很有帮助。

PS:寻找 Java/C++ 中的方法。

0 投票
5 回答
20921 浏览

linux - 当父进程被“kill -9”杀死时,子进程也会被杀死吗?

今天早上我的一位同事告诉我,当他通过“kill -9”杀死supervisord时,supervisord的子进程没有被杀死。

他对此非常肯定,但我尝试了很多次,并没有发现这种情况。

那么当父进程被“kill -9”杀死时,linux会确保它的子进程也被杀死吗?

0 投票
6 回答
674 浏览

windows - 当 Windows 进入可怕的 100% cpu 使用僵尸模式时该怎么办

偶尔发生在我身上:

我在 Visual Studio 中启动我的程序,由于一些错误,我的程序进入 100% cpu 使用率并且基本上完全冻结了窗口。

只有完全耐心地请求任务管理器(需要永远来绘制自己),我才能终止我的进程。

其他人有时也会遇到这种情况吗?是否有一个巧妙的技巧可以让这个过程停止(除了拔掉插头并可能破坏高清文件)?如果任务管理器不小心出现,现在需要 5-10 分钟才能正确杀死它,我必须先请求这个

R

ps 奇怪的是,“多任务操作系统”仍然可以让进程占用如此多的时间,以至于无法再做其他事情。我的程序甚至没有提高它的线程优先级或任何东西

0 投票
11 回答
1732667 浏览

linux - 杀死分离的屏幕会话

我从某个地方了解到一个分离的屏幕可以被杀死

[session # you want to kill] 可以从哪里得到

但这不起作用。哪里不对了?正确的方法是什么?